An earthquake of magnitude 4.6 hit Ladakh on Monday, June 28, 2021, but there were no reports of any damage, officials said. The quake struck at 6:10 am in Leh area of the Union Territory, the officials said. They said its epicenter was at a latitude of 34.49 degrees north and longitude of 78.43 degrees east at a depth of 18 km.More Related News
